Output 34a580a2362dd3ce604b0e369bde8e5b68421f4d45efa58c893f24d25e4fa9df:2

value
806922
script pubkey
OP_0 OP_PUSHBYTES_20 7df4a860e8808023f343210e1d83d7fd42d6518d
address
bc1q0h62sc8gszqz8u6ryy8pmq7hl4pdv5vdtaxq96
transaction
34a580a2362dd3ce604b0e369bde8e5b68421f4d45efa58c893f24d25e4fa9df